Slaughterhouse PD Dharma Jaya Applies Semi-mechanical Technology

Total cost for the line system is very expensive due to high electricity costs

City-owned slaughterhouse PD Dharma Jaya applies semi-mechanical technology at the Cakung Slaughterhouse (RPH), East Jakarta.

PD Dharma Jaya Business Director, Mohamad Adam Ali Bhutto said that it is for efficient RPH function and cost leadership. Previously the system was a line system technology system.

"Total cost for the line system is very expensive due to high electricity costs. It was previously used because of the high rate of slaughter of cattle between 700-1,000 animals per day. But its number decreased to 80 animals per day in line with the increase in the volume of imported meat and cattle slaughtering," he explained, Tuesday (9/17).

This engineering way is done in stages and involves customers to seek input thus they feel comfortable with such changes. It is targeted for completion this year.

"Thus far we have spent Rp 70 million of the total needed for engineering technology around Rp. 300 million until the end of this year," he expressed.

Currently the current slaughter room with line system is split into two, one into a smaller-sized system line room and one semi-mechanical slaughter room.

"One other line system is also split into two semi-mechanical slaughter rooms. So the total room becomes one line system and three semi-mechanical rooms," he said.
